Originally Posted by cotter77
how does one credit miles to the airline of choice within the *A?

before, during, or after travel?
what action must you take? can i credit mileage to a FF program of an airline I have never flown before?....

can I transfer UA mileage plus over to Aegean?
When you buy the ticket, or at the airport before the flight, have the carrier you are flying on put the *A partner number on your ticket. You can credit any flight on any *A carrier to the FF account of any other *A carrier (does not matter if you have flown that carrier or not). Once it is in one carriers FF program the miles will stay there and there is no real way of transferring. HOWEVER, be aware that the mileage earning on various *A carriers are different - depending on what the fare code is (discount Y, F, C, full Y etc)
